    Even with all the success, the Spurs have had their fair share of heartbreak.

    We win the le in 99, then just before the playoffs in 00, Duncan gets injured and we get ousted in the first round.

    Then the following two seasons, we get ousted by the Lakers....one of those years, we had a legit shot at beating them. Unfortunately, during the Dallas series, Anderson was injured on a cheap shot, and was never really healthy for the Lakers. It would have been tough to win the series anyway, but take away our best perimeter player at the time and forget about it.

    04, we are the defending Champs....and here we are in San Antonio. Duncan makes a miraculous shot over Shaq to give us the lead with 0.4 seconds left in the game. We all figure we have this game and will close it out in LA. But no. Fisher makes the most heartbreaking shot in the history of the Spurs franchise. We lose that game, and the next....then we watch the Lakers simply lay down and quit against the Pistons....just horrible.

    In 06, we are once again the defending champs.....and we are playing the Mavs. The Series is super even. Any team can take it. Well we go up 3 late in game 7. Dirk drives, minimal contact by Manu....Hoop and the harm. He makes the FT, and ties it. We take it down and Duncan misses a layup, Manu misses a putback. We go into OT and lose. The Mavs go onto the Finals and choke away a 2 game lead, as well as a double digit lead in game 3 and lose the finals 4-2 to the Heat. HORRIBLE.

    In 08, we are once again the champs. we make it to the WCF. However, Manu is injured. Pop refuses to give Barry extra minutes. We blow two huge 2nd half leads. Barry gets raped by Fisher at the end of game 5, no call. Lakers go on to the Finals.....and get beat down by the Celtics. HORRIBLE.

    09, we are the 3 seed. We are playing the Mavs, and once again Manu is hurt. We have a rookie named Hill, but Pop is stubborn and simply wont put him in until it is too late. The Mavs upset us in 5 games.


    So while the Spurs have tasted a lot of success, they have also been crushed in ways that very few have. I think the reason 04, 06, and 08 are so tough to deal with is because when the Lakers and Mavs beat us, they went on to the Finals and basically bent over and took it up the ass with zero lube to ease the pain. I mean, they fought so hard and gave every ounce of what they had to eliminate the Spurs, but didn't bring the same effort in the Finals.....just frustrates me to no end. IMO, we beat the Heat and Celtics.....not sure if we beat the Pistons in 04 though.

    Plus, we Spurs fans have had to deal with not being able to repeat, we are dirty, we are soft, we are old, we get all the calls, we kill ratings.....etc.

    I vote for Spurs fans.
